It's a relatively uncommon structure for gambling, and things that do work that way (like casual sports bets between friends) are often exempt from local gambling laws. Traditional sports betting was done directly between a gambler and their sportsbook of choice at whatever profit-maximizing odds the bookie chose.
In other parts of the world, betting exchanges like BetFair operate this way, but unlike Kalshi, there's no pretence that what's occurring is anything other than gambling, and they are heavily regulated like other sports betting operators.
